Now, it is certain that the Central Bank Cheque was issued in the Name of the Plateau State
Government. There is NO follow-up Directive from the Federal Government of Nigeria that Payments
in the Sum of N66Million was for the benefit of 274 PDP Wards and the Sum of N10Million to Senator
Mantu, was for the benefit of Ten (10) Plateau Central Zones. Even on the assumption that these
Payments were legitimate, it might well have been ordered to be paid from the Plateau State
Government’s Account and not from the Central Bank of Nigeria Cheque meant to meet the plight of
the Citizens of Plateau State, who were facing Ecological Problems that needed Reclamation and
Channelization.
It is worthy of note that this Distribution List as contained in the Defendant’s Extra-Judicial Statement,
whether true or an afterthought still does not MATERIALLY change the Purpose Mandate, which was,
to Solve Ecological Problems in Plateau State. In fact, the Extra-Judicial Statement, further drove home
the point that the Monies were disposed of or used for Purposes other than for the Actual Purpose it
was meant for.
